DLI releases report on PTSD claims in Minnesota's workers’ compensation system

New report available graphic

In 2023, the Minnesota Legislature directed the Department of Labor and Industry (DLI) to conduct a study on post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D) claims in the workers’ compensation system and issue a report with its findings and recommendations by Aug. 1, 2025.

DLI partnered with the Midwest Center for Occupational Health and Safety at the University of Minnesota to complete the PTSD study and prepare the report.

The report, "Evaluating PTSD claims in Minnesota’s workers’ compensation system: Findings and recommendations," provides a comprehensive examination and analysis of PTSD claims in the system.

MNOSHA fatality, serious-injury investigation summaries online

Each month, Minnesota OSHA (MNOSHA) Compliance publishes current, updated summaries of its fatality investigations and serious-injury investigations.

For the federal-fiscal-year that began Oct. 1, 2024, MNOSHA has investigated 15 fatalities through July 29.

The information provided about each investigation is:  the inspection number, date of incident and worksite city; the type of business and number of employees; a description of the event; and the outcome of the MNOSHA Compliance investigation.
